Editor shooting suspects finally out on bail

[Sunday Express - Lesotho] - 14/12/2025
Moorosi Tsiane NEARLY a decade after the near-fatal shooting of former Lesotho Times editor, Lloyd Mutungamiri, two of the four soldiers accused of carrying out the attack have finally been released on bail. Brigadier Rapele Mphaki and Lance Corporal Maribe Nathane, accused of the 9 July 2016 (…)
